Mon. March 26 1866 Called at Guthries he agreed to give us an order on Livingston to the amt. Due us for (?) At Mrs Hare's Maxwell's (?) Sewing machines notices Eld. Janes here to dinner Tues March 27 Took Pa & Aunt Clara to Townsends then went to wIlloughbys to get (?) McIntosh he agrees to come next Saturday & took dinner at Kinghes Quite cold today Miss Wilson here after school. Wed March 28th 1866 The ground is all covered with snow The boys drew 1 ld of straw with oxen 1 ld with horses Eugene & I drew 1 ld with horses S & H Peck & wives were here visiting today
